Ingredients for 1 servings:
- 375 g powdered sugar
- 100 g dark chocolate
- 90 g cocoa powder
- 1 pinch(s) salt
- 1 egg(s) size L
- 2 egg whites size L
- 60 g hazelnuts or other nuts
Instructions
Working time approx. 20 minutes; Rest time approx. 1 hour; Cooking/baking time approx. 15 minutes; Total time approx. 1 hour 35 minutes
simple, gluten-free chocolate cookies
Sift the icing sugar and cocoa powder into a bowl, add a pinch of salt and mix. Add the egg and egg white. Roughly chop the dark chocolate and add it to the bowl and mix well. Optionally, you can also mix in roughly chopped hazelnuts, almonds or similar. Place one tablespoon of batter per cookie onto the baking sheet lined with baking paper. It is important to leave enough space between the cookies, as they will rise and expand considerably. Bake in an oven preheated to 175°C with a convection grill (fan with top heat) on the middle rack for 15 minutes, until they break open. Then let them cool completely on the baking paper, otherwise they will still be too soft and stick to the baking paper.
